Types 1 and 2:Fair-skinned and red-headed people, who burn easily without tanning and Scandinavian-type skins which tan lightly, should avoid the sun and use high protection (factors 30-50) all holiday.
Type 3: Brunettes with fair skin who tan slowly but also burn easily, should start off on factor 30, then gradually come down to 20 or 15.
Type 4: Olive and dark-skinned people who tan easily without burning are the most resistant to sun damage. If you don’t live in a sunny climate, you should start off on 30 for a couple of days however, before dropping to 15 and then 10.
